Winchester Super X Model 1

That’s your recoil buffer squished above the recoil spring tube. Needs replacing. Yes, should lift out with light prying but likely brittle and will crumble. That gun has seen some use but well looked after.

Well.... I was trying to be gentle. Close look at the recoil spring tube shows it’s been getting beat up from lack of a bolt buffer which also stresses your bolt slide. That gun has seen a fair amount of shells through it.
 
Well.... I was trying to be gentle. Close look at the recoil spring tube shows it’s been getting beat up from lack of a bolt buffer which also stresses your bolt slide. That gun has seen a fair amount of shells through it.

Yup sure has and as you said it's being used without a new buffer and everything is taking a pounding because of it. The one inherent flaw in the SX1 was that buffer due to the material it was made from.

When I did my three SX1's after purchasing them I swapped everything in the stock except the one I bought that was NIB as I had no intention of shooting it. The rebound springs get weak just from age and being compressed for 45-50 years even when not used. If you've ever seen what happens when that spring is too weak you'll change it to prevent a problem.
